5 to Try: Chocolate Desserts 5 to Try: Chocolate Desserts RSS

By Citysearch Editors, Twin Cities

Satisfy your chocolate craving with a decadent cake, melt-in-your-mouth pastry or another sinful dessert at a top Twin Cities restaurant or bakery.

5 to Try

  1. Tejas

    3910 W 50th St, Minneapolis, MN
    The chocolate-chocolate chip fritters with fiery fudge sauce are divine--a perfect ending to the always innovative Southwestern cuisine.

  2. La Fougasse

    5601 W 78th St, Minneapolis, MN
    Wine, chocolate, fruit--ah, the French. Try the poached pear swimming in rich chocolate fondant, covered with chocolate ganache.

  3. Cafe Latte

    850 Grand Ave, St Paul, MN
    The turtle cake: A layered extravaganza of devil's food cake, oozing caramel and pecans, is draped in chocolate fudge frosting.

  4. Barbette

    1600 W Lake St, Minneapolis, MN
    Dipping fresh fruit into this deep, dark espresso chocolate fondue is incredibly decadent and seductive.

  5. St. Paul Grill

    350 Market St, St Paul, MN
    Five inches of rich chocolate cake and mousse covered with ganache. So rich, it comes with a shot of milk on the side.
